Transaction 34fe730e959abc9e69d606c223cce711725f327f86d4f210e5e96e408151ac3e

1 Input
2 Outputs
  • 34fe730e959abc9e69d606c223cce711725f327f86d4f210e5e96e408151ac3e:0
  • value  1010280
    address  3CTW5tSJntrvTtWAuKTjEwTr6fHSiJxWZR
  • 34fe730e959abc9e69d606c223cce711725f327f86d4f210e5e96e408151ac3e:1
  • value  374816296
    address  bc1q7xlmcyhp824qcc3dpk500zsar8d3wcw7akz8vs